OSHA Injury Report: Loc Performance
Injury · Other recordable case
At a glance
On , an injury at Loc Performance in 1115 S Wayne St, St Marys, OH 45885 resulted in other recordable case. Employee was rubber Track Operator in rubber goods, mechanical (i.e., extruded, lathe-cut, molded), manufacturing.

Before the incident
Remove empty poly roll from the build machine
What happened
She cut the poly roll with a knife and the knife slipped
Injury or illness
laceration
Object or substance involved
A knife
Summary line
laceration with a knife cutting polyurethane from a roll
